Instead, they came up with interesting activities in their childhood. Have you ever joined in these activities? Kicking stone balls During the Qing Dynasty, kicking a stone ball around was a popular game in the northern part of China, and it was often played in winter to keep warm. People could not only have fun, but also do exercise. Playing hide-and-seek Hide-and-seek was popular for children around the nation. There were some ways to play this game: covering a child’s eyes while other kids ran around to play little tricks on him, or more commonly, others hid and one child must try to find them. Flying kites Kites have quite a long history. The earliest kites were made of wood instead of paper. The three most famous kites were the Beijing kite, the Tianjin kite and the Weifang kite. Each had its own characteristics. For example, the bird-shaped kite with long wings was a spacial kind of the Beijing kite. Watching shadow (影子) plays The closest thing to watching a film during ancient times was going to see a shadow play. The artists controlled puppets (木偶) behind the screen and told stories to the music. 41.According to the passage, ________ is popular in the northern part of China. Instead, they came up with interesting activities in their childhood.”以及后续对几种古代儿童活动的介绍可知,本文主要介绍了古代中国儿童在没有现代娱乐设备的情况下所参与的几种有趣的活动。故选A。 B On the side of a road in a nature reserve in Northwest China’s Qinghai Province,tourists might see a fat wolf. It wags (摇摆) its tail and shows its belly (肚子) in front of the passing cars in the hope of getting a meal. However, it was nothing but skin and bones a few months ago. It’s said that the old hungry wolf was kicked out of the wolf pack because of its poor hunting ability. But that all changed after a driver gave it two pies and shared a video of it online in July, 2023. Because of the video, the wolf became a superstar and a lot of people came to the area to provide it with food. Since then, the wolf has given up hunting and turned to passers-by for snacks that are often high in oil, sugar and salt such as pies and roasted chicken. While some people are joking that the wolf looks like a pet dog, others express their worries about the wolf. Some scientists are calling on the public to stop feeding it. The wolf is losing its ability to survive in nature, which is fatal (致命的) to the wild animal. “In nature, animals are born and die. They have their own laws of survival,” said Dai Qiang, an animal researcher. He also points out the risks of feeding wild animals. Wild animals, especially those that get hurt, carry disease-causing bacteria (细菌), and getting too close to the animals like wild wolves can also be dangerous. Qi Xinzhang, deputy director of Xining Wildlife Park, mentioned, “It is a good thing that the event has caught people’s attention. If a wild wolf needs help, it should be reported to the forestry (林业) department. Casual (随意的) feed ing should be avoided. Only when people have a better knowledge of wildlife can they care about a wildlife in the right way.” 46.Why does the wolf appear in front of passing drivers? A.To ask for some food. Wheat sprouts (发芽) from the soil. Purple eggplant (茄子) flowers come out. But you’re not on a farm. You are inside Yuegong, a closed lab at Beihang University in Beijing. An important experiment was once carried out in the lab. It is called Yuegong-365. Eight volunteers took turns to live by themselves in the closed lab for a year. In January 2018, four volunteers finished spending 200 days in the lab. This set a world record for the longest stay in a self-contained (自给自足的) space, China Daily reported. Then, another four volunteers lived in the lab and the experiment ended in May that year. The experiment could give scientists information that can be used to create better living areas for astronauts in space, Xinhua News Agency reported. Life in Yuegong was busy. Volunteers got up at 6:30 am and went to bed at 11:30 pm. Growing food was their daily activity. There were more than 30 kinds of vegetables and fruit for them to grow and eat. They even ate insects in order to get protein (蛋白质). They also recorded their body temperature, blood pressure and personal feelings every day. Scientists outside the lab used the information to monitor (监控) their health. Was living in the lab boring? No! With internet, volunteers could go online to read the news or watch TV shows. They also read books, wrote and even rode bikes. “There’s no time to be bored,” volunteer Hu Jingfei said.
